    “Final line-up and stage times announced for Coughlan’s Live Music Festival 2014”

    Coughlan’s of Douglas Street, Cork has revealed the final line-up and stage times for Coughlan’s Live Music Festival 2014, a six-day music spree which runs from the 24th to the 29th of September.
    The festival will showcase some of Ireland’s finest established performers as well as a host of new and up-and-coming artists. Featured in the line-up is Cork songwriter Anna Mitchell, fresh from an appearance at Electric Picnic over the weekend. She launches her debut EP, Fall Like That, with a show at the festival.
    New York born Hank Wedel, one of Cork’s stalworth musicians, will also launch his new single, We Were So Close,
    Highlights of the festival line up include the ever charismatic Jerry Fish and Blarney native, Mick Flannery, whose show on Saturday the 27th is already sold out. Waterford’s Katie Kim also joins the bill as a special guest to Adrian Crowley.
    There are a number of free performances throughout the festival including The Booka Brass Band, R.S.A.G and John Blek & the Rats, The Hot Sprockets & more as well as the quirky addition of a 'Silent Disco'.
    It is recommended arriving early for these shows as space in the ‘little venue with massive heart’ is limited.
    Tickets go on sale this Friday the 5th of September from 9am. Tickets available online and direct from venue

    Its been two years since Coughlans Live, "the little room with the massive heart" (G-man Blog), opened it's doors and quickly established itself as one of Cork's finest live music venues.

    Two highly successful festivals, A Hot Press Commendation and an IMRO Live Music Venue of the Year award later and Coughlan's Live Promotions is set to stretch out beyond the boundaries of the intimate music room, bringing some of the finest Irish and International acts to venues across the city.


    This promising enterprise will debut with a very special double bill featuring two of the finest Cork based artists, Marc O'Reilly and The Hard Ground. Thursday October 9th, upstairs at The Oliver Plunkett.Adm €10
